Disney is hiring a Software Engineer II

About the Role

Disney is looking for a Software Engineer II to join the API Services team within Disney Entertainment and ESPN Product & Technology. In this role, you will build highly available, high-throughput services critical to delivering content to subscribers, focusing on big data and backend engineering.

What You'll Do

  • Be part of a team of big data and backend engineers to deliver high-value projects.
  • Build components of a large-scale data platform for real-time and batch processing.
  • Own features of big data applications to fit evolving business needs.
  • Participate in building the next-generation service platform on cloud-based big data infrastructure.
  • Continuously improve performance, scalability, and availability.
  • Participate in sprint planning, backlog refinement, and retrospectives.
  • Build automated tests to ensure application reliability.
  • Participate in code reviews.

What We're Looking For

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or a related field, or equivalent training or work experience.
  • 3+ years of experience in a technical field.
  • Ability to work with team members and project management to understand requirements and provide technical solutions.
  • Comfort with ambiguity and being part of conversations with discordant views.
  • Intermediate understanding of software development fundamentals and architecture.
  • Experience with Java and Scala, and associated technologies.
  • Experience building and maintaining highly automated systems using tools like Jenkins, Cloud Formation, Terraform, Kubernetes, and Spinnaker.

Nice to Have

  • Interest in or experience with web technologies and web system architecture.
  • Knowledge or experience with AWS products and services (EC2, S3, Lambda, DynamoDB, ElastiCache, CloudFront, etc.) or other cloud providers.

Technical Stack

  • Languages: Scala, Java, Python
  • Data Processing: Apache Flink, Spark, Databricks
  • Cloud (AWS): ECS, Lambda, DynamoDB, Kinesis, CloudFront, WAF
